Abstract

The rolling screen comprises a supporting frame, an extension plate is fixedly arranged on one side of the supporting frame, a discharging groove is formed in the center of the supporting frame, a power mechanism is arranged at the top end of the extension plate, a limiting frame is fixedly arranged at the top end of the supporting frame, and a rolling screen is arranged on the limiting frame. A limiting plate is slidably arranged on the outer side of the limiting frame, a protective cover is slidably arranged in the limiting frame, and a hanging ring is fixedly arranged on the outer side of the protective cover. The motor drives the rotating shaft to rotate, so that the second roller is driven to rotate, the first roller rotates, the screen drum is driven to rotate for screening work, the height of the motor is adjusted by rotating the screw rod, and therefore the extrusion force between the first roller and the second roller is adjusted; the screw is rotated to drive the motor to move downwards, so that the first roller is separated from the second roller, then the motor can be directly disassembled, and maintenance and replacement of power equipment are facilitated.

Description

TECHNICAL FIELD

[0001] The utility model relates to the screening equipment field, concretely is a kind of rollable sieve that can be assembled and disassembled. BACKGROUND

[0002] Rollable sieve is a kind of equipment using the rotation of drum to realize material screening;It is widely used in various industries, such as mining, building materials, chemical industry, etc., mainly used for classifying and screening granular or blocky materials.

[0003] The power mechanism is generally directly connected with the sieve cylinder when the rollable sieve is used, so it is time-consuming and laborious when the equipment is installed, and when the power mechanism needs to be replaced and repaired, the direct connection will cause inconvenience to replacement and repair, thereby reducing the practicability of the rollable sieve, so there is an urgent need for a device to solve the above problems. DETAILED DESCRIPTION

[0019] Please refer to Figs. 1-3 The utility model provides a detachable rolling sieve, including support frame 1, support frame 1 one side welding fixed with extension plate 14, support frame 1 center position is set with blanking groove 15, extension plate 14 top end has power mechanism, support frame 1 top end welding fixed with limiting frame 7, limiting frame 7 outside slide limiting plate 8, limiting plate 8 has four, symmetrically installs in limiting frame 7 both sides position, limiting frame 7 inside slide protective cover 2, protective cover 2 outside welding fixed with lifting ring 3, lifting ring 3 has four, symmetrically fixed in protective cover 2 both sides position, protective cover 2 inboard welding fixed with fixed ring 5, fixed ring 5 inside movable inlay has sieve cylinder 4, sieve cylinder 4 one side is fixed with first roller 6 through bolt, first roller 6 outside face is rough surface, when using, protective cover 2 is settled in limiting frame 7 inside, then limiting plate 8 is passed in, removes to protective cover 2 top end, so can limit protective cover 2 position, make protective cover 2 fixed in limiting frame 7 inside, the installation work of convenient equipment, then power mechanism drives first roller 6 rotation, can carry out screening work, when disassembling, disassembles limiting plate 8, then through lifting ring 3 hoisting, can disassemble protective cover 2.

[0020] The power mechanism comprises a screw rod 11, a positioning rod 10, a motor 9, a rotating shaft 13 and a second roller 12, the screw rod 11 passes through the extension plate 14 through threads, the positioning rod 10 movably penetrates the extension plate 14, the positioning rod 10 is two and symmetrically installed on both sides of the extension plate 14, the motor 9 is fixed on the top end of the positioning rod 10 through a mounting frame, the top end of the screw rod 11 is movably embedded in the lower end of the mounting frame of the motor 9, the rotating shaft 13 is fixed on the output end position of the motor 9 through a shaft coupling, the second roller 12 is fixed on one side of the rotating shaft 13 through bolts, the outer side of the second roller 12 is a rough surface, and the top end of the second roller 12 is tightly attached to the lower end of the first roller 6, in use, the motor 9 is started, the motor 9 drives the rotating shaft 13 to rotate, thus driving the second roller 12 to rotate, so that the first roller 6 rotates, thereby driving the screen cylinder 4 to rotate for screening work, and the height of the motor 9 is adjusted by rotating the screw rod 11, so as to adjust the extrusion force between the first roller 6 and the second roller 12, when disassembling, since the first roller 6 and the second roller 12 are in direct contact, the motor 9 is driven to move downward by rotating the screw rod 11, so that the first roller 6 and the second roller 12 are separated, and then the motor 9 can be directly disassembled, which is convenient for maintenance and replacement of the power equipment.
